The #1 Plattsburgh State Cardinals would host the #3 Cortland State Red Dragons in the 2019 N.E.W.H.L. Championship. The Cardinals would take the early 1-0 lead four minutes into the first period from Erin McArdle. The Cardinals would extend the lead to 2-0 in the last few seconds of the first period on the Hanna Rose goal. In the second period Courtney Moriarty would get the goal at 6:34 for the 3-0 in the second period. Then three minutes later Annie Katonka would score to make it 4-0 Cardinals. Then in the final minute of the period Taylor Whitney would score for the 5-0 lead. That would end the scoring as there was nothing in the third period and the Cardinals would get the 5-0 victory to claim the 2019 NEWHL Chanpionship. The top seeded Plattsburgh State Cardinals would host the 4 seeded Oswego State Lakers in the semi-finals of the NEWHL Hockey Tournament at the Field House in front of 500 people. The Cardinals would get the lone goal of the first period on the power play from Nicole Unsworth for the 1-0 lead after one. In the second period the Cardinals would get three goals in the period from Kaitlin Drew-Mead, Madison Walker and Mackenize Millen for the 4-1 lead after the second period. The Cardinals would strike again in the third period for three more goals from Courtney Moriarity, Annie Katonka, and Nicole Unsworth (second of the night) to secure the 7-1 victory. In the winning effort Kassi Abbott would make 17 saves as the Cardinals advance to the championship game of the NEWHL against either Potsdam State or Cortland State next weekend. Gallery.

The #3 Plattsburgh State Cardinals would host the #6 Brockport State Golden Eagles in the Quarterfinals of the SUNYAC Tournament. The Golden Eagles would take the early 1-0 lead just 2:17 into the game. That would be the only scoring all the way til the 6:48 mark of the third period when Matt Araujo would score to tie the game at one. The Cardinals would take the lead just 80 seconds later on Cole Stallard's goal to make it a 2-1 Cardinals lead. The Cardinals would add a empty netter in the closing minute from Ross Sloan to secure the 3-1 victory. In the winning effort Johnny Poreda would make 30 saves as the Cardinals advance to the semi-finals and a matchup with Oswego State. Gallery.
